The distance between Melbourne and Kabupaten Pulau Morotai is 4773 km.
It takes approximately 23h 12m to get from Melbourne to Kabupaten Pulau Morotai, including transfers.
Kabupaten Pulau Morotai is 1h behind Melbourne. It is currently 11:34 AM in Melbourne and 10:34 AM in Kabupaten Pulau Morotai.

There is no direct connection from Melbourne to Kabupaten Pulau Morotai. However, you can take the bus to Melbourne Airport T3 Skybus/Arrival Dr, walk to Melbourne Airport (MEL) airport, fly to Pitu Airport (OTI), then travel to Kabupaten Pulau Morotai. Alternatively, you can take the train to Lara Station, walk to Lara Station/Hicks St, take the line 18 bus to Avalon Airport Terminal/Airport Dr, walk to Avalon Airport (AVV) airport, fly to Pitu Airport (OTI), then travel to Kabupaten Pulau Morotai.
